    ''Christian Presence in the Holy Land ''is a comprehensive, well documented book depicting the various features of Christian life in the Holy Land- past history, present circumstances and future prospects, Written by an authority in Christian affairs with a long record of over forty years of service as chairman of elected Orthodox communal councils in Israel, it is perhaps one of the few authentic records on the subject published by a native Palestinian Christian.

    Yossi Sarid, ex-leader of the left wing Israeli party MERETZ who served as minister of education in the Israeli government mourns the Jewish Pentecost feast Shavuot the holiday he once "loved above all others for its graciousness and compassion" . Sarid wonders how the right wing leaders have hijacked even this feast in the name of the Torah and wonders how the Torah handed down at Sinai authorized us to dispossess, deport and seal houses; and why a Hebron market street stands empty.
